Second Leg of Premier Quarter Sires Crowns Big Champions With Big Checks

By: Brittany Bevis

While APHA competitors are headed home this week after a long stint in Fort Worth for the AjPHA Youth World Championship Show, AQHA exhibitors are enjoying sunny skies and sizzling competition at the Stars N Stripes and Big A currently underway in Conyers, GA.

The Stars N Stripes portion of the event recently concluded with a whopping 8,000 total entries. Click here to view complete results from Mark Harrell Horse Shows and great photos courtesy of Lisa Lee. One of the main events at the circuit was the Big A Huntfield Derby with big winners including David Miller with Enjoyable in the Low Derby, Olivia Derlis with ATM in the Low Derby Non Pro division, and Hannah Bedwell with DoYou Have TheMagic in the High Derby and Non Pro High Derby. Click here to view results from that event.

Another big draw for the Big A this year has been the Premier Quarter Sires classes with the second leg of their 2017 circuit taking place over the past several days. Big winners thus far have included Brittany Andrews with Faith Is Certain, who took home $8,900 and a belt buckle from Shea Michelle Buckle Designs in the 3-Year-Old Limited Horse Limited Rider Western Pleasure. Faith Is Certain is by Pleasure For Certain and out of Always Good Faith and is owned by Lee and Brenda Looney Quarter Horses, LLC. The Reserve Champion was Blake Weis with I’m Fun Sized for Ronda Roozeboom, who received $5,900. I’m Fun Sized is by A Touch Of Sudden and out of Laced With Chex.

Brittany Andrews

3-Year-Old Limited Horse Limited Rider Western Pleasure Champion- Brittany Andrews with Faith Is Certain

In the 3-Year-Old Limited Horse Limited Rider Hunter Under Saddle, Julian Harris rode Al Wayz On Your Mind, by Allocate Your Assets and out of Your Arts Desire, to win for owner Sarah Nimigan. This team received $8,800 and a buckle from Shea Michelle Buckle Designs. The Reserve Champion was Mandy Gately with Re Allocate, by Allocate Your Assets and out of Maid For Luke, for Mark and Courtney Brockmueller. They received $5,500.
